(Jun. 05, 2009  2:03 PM)Ghost Wrote: Zombies are beyblades that steal spin from the opponent because of near circular Attack Ring.. and usually a free spinning tip using a nsk bearing in the SG...They are known to spin long, and are able to spin after death cuz of their round shapes..
Currently there are no Zombies possible in MFB..

mmm... and the opposite spin direction?
Basically a zombie MUST have more endurance than opponent bey, and then why not steal spin from the other bey with opposite rotation sense?
